Fazlul Huq Montu, Azam Khasru and Molla Abul Kalam Azad were made Sramik League new president, general secretary and executive oresident respectively.

Awami League general secretary Obaidul Quader announced their names in the afternoon on Saturday.

Earlier, the prime minister inaugurated the council of Sramik League through hoisting the national flag with national anthem playing.

Chaired by Jatiya Sramik League president Sukkur Mahmud, the function was addressed, among others, by labour and manpower affairs secretary Habibur Rahman Siraj, state minister for labour and employment Begum Munnujan Sufian, ILO country director Tuomo Poutiainen, general secretary of the ITUC Asia-Pacific Shoya Yoshida and General of South Asian Regional Trade Union Council Laxman Bahadur Basnet.

Sramik League general secretary Sirajul Islam delivered the welcome speech while executive president Fazlul Huq Montu read out the condolence motion.

Father of the Nation Bangabandhu Sheikh Mujibur Rahman founded the Sramik League in 1969 aiming to protect the rights of workers.

The last council session of the Jatiya Sramik League was held seven years back on 17 July 2019, when Sukkur Mahmud and Sirajul Islam were made president and secretary respectively.
